Good Manufacturing Practices

from class:

Biomedical Engineering II

Definition

Good Manufacturing Practices (GMP) are a set of guidelines and regulations that ensure the consistent quality and safety of products, especially in industries like pharmaceuticals and medical devices. These practices encompass everything from the manufacturing process to quality control, ensuring that products meet predetermined specifications and are free from contamination. Compliance with GMP is crucial for regulatory approval and helps maintain consumer trust in the products being produced.

5 Must Know Facts For Your Next Test

  1. GMP guidelines cover all aspects of production, including personnel, premises, equipment, documentation, and processes.
  2. Adhering to GMP helps minimize the risks involved in pharmaceutical production that cannot be eliminated through testing the final product alone.
  3. Inspections for GMP compliance are conducted by regulatory agencies to ensure that manufacturers are maintaining appropriate standards.
  4. Training of staff is essential under GMP to ensure everyone involved understands their role in maintaining product quality and safety.
  5. Non-compliance with GMP can lead to severe consequences, including product recalls, fines, and loss of market access.

Review Questions

  • How do Good Manufacturing Practices impact the reliability of controlled drug delivery systems?
    • Good Manufacturing Practices play a crucial role in ensuring that controlled drug delivery systems are consistently produced to high-quality standards. By adhering to GMP, manufacturers can prevent contamination and variability in product formulation, which is essential for ensuring that drugs are delivered at the correct dosage and timing. This reliability is critical for patient safety and the overall efficacy of drug therapies.
  • Discuss the role of documentation in Good Manufacturing Practices and its significance in quality management systems.
    • Documentation is a vital component of Good Manufacturing Practices as it provides evidence of compliance with quality standards and procedures. It includes detailed records of manufacturing processes, quality control measures, and training activities. This meticulous record-keeping not only facilitates traceability and accountability but also plays a significant role during regulatory inspections, ensuring that all practices adhere to established guidelines within quality management systems.
  • Evaluate the potential consequences of failing to comply with Good Manufacturing Practices in the production of medical devices.
    • Failure to comply with Good Manufacturing Practices can have serious repercussions in the production of medical devices, ranging from safety risks to legal penalties. Non-compliance may lead to defective products entering the market, resulting in harm to patients and legal liabilities for manufacturers. Additionally, regulatory bodies may impose fines or revoke licenses, which can cripple a companyโ€™s operations. The reputational damage associated with such failures can also deter future customers and investors, highlighting the critical importance of adhering to GMP.
